PCA(P)(2025)22 - Serious Shortage Protocol Extension: Estradot® Patches
SSPs for Estradot HRT patches extended to 5 Dec 2025. Pharmacists may substitute with Evorel or Estraderm MX. Review updated guidance.

PCA(P)(2025)21 - Serious Shortage Protocol Extension: Cefalexin Oral Suspension
Serious Shortage Protocols for cefalexin oral suspension sugar free products extended to 24 Oct 2025. Applies to SSP077 and SSP078. Review updated guidance.
